Define Historical Development of Food Processing?
Food processing began thousands of years ago to help people keep food through the lean seasons. Several methods of preserving food have been around for a long time. The processes of smoking, drying (dehydration) and using salt and spices to prevent spoilage have been used for thousands of years. All of these methods were based on desiccation or dehydration. Grains and nuts were the first foods to be dried using the naturally available sunlight and air. Mechanical methods of drying were developed in the late 1700s. Dried foods are popular because they are compact, lightweight and last much longer than the fresh foods. Cheese-making was an accidental discovery, which became established as a method for increasing the longevity of milk. The process of canning was pioneered in the 1790s when Nicolas Appert, a French Confectioner, discovered that the application of heat to food in sealed glass bottles preserved the food from deterioration. Napoleon-I gave Appert 12,000 Francs to make his invention public. Napoleon was highly interested in Appert's invention because of its potential to supply food to the armed forces who were many miles away from home. Appert published several books for canning and started the canning industry. Around 1806, the French Navy had undertaken successful training of Appert's principles on a wide range of foods including meat, vegetables, fruit and milk. Before the year 1860, changes in food were described on the theory of spontaneous generation. Pasteur demonstrated that ferments, molds and some other forms of putrefaction were caused by the presence of microorganisms widely distributed in the environment. As these microorganisms are the major cause of food spoilage, food preservation relies on rendering conditions unfavorable for their growth.
